Output 5a58f8718cda529d857117c91bd3ab9b566b2a13af0564889b94844b80588993:27

value
3441584
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 985375def3d4e9afcceb6a386cac1cdab8277def OP_EQUALVERIFY OP_CHECKSIG
address
1EtRh6GQeFUgqxKv3WioVuCgSv7Uufaz9d
transaction
5a58f8718cda529d857117c91bd3ab9b566b2a13af0564889b94844b80588993
spent
true